Electrical socket, cargo compartment
- Remove the seat cushion by pulling it up at the front edge on both sides. It is secured by two holders on the lower side.
- Fold the right-hand backrest forward.
- Remove the left side cushion by pulling the upper edge backwards until the hooks (1) release. Then pull the cushion inwards slightly so that the hook (2) releases and then pull upwards until the locating pin (3) unhooks from the mounting at the lower edge.
- Detach the C-pillar panel at the lower edge by prying out the lower edge until the two clips release. Angle out the lower edge of the panel and then unhook the upper edge.
- Remove the headlining panel by first pulling the rear edge downward so that the four clips release. Then unhook the front edge.
- Remove the smaller headlining panel by pulling it laterally so that the two hooks release. Then unhook the front edge of the panel.
- Remove the cargo compartment floor.
- Fold out the two loading eyelets on the side panel.
- Insert tool 99905919 into the holes on the upper edge of the cover. Turn the tool and pull off the cover.
- Remove the screws for the loading eyelets.
- Slacken off the two screws on the sill panel.
- Remove the sill panel by pulling it straight up so that the six clips release.
- Remove the screw (1).
- Remove the right-hand side panel by detaching and angling out the upper edge.
- Find the embossing on the reverse of the panel.
- Measure and mark the centre of the embossing using a scriber.
- Pre-drill using a - 3 mm (1/8") bit.
- Drill out the hole. Use a -27 mm (1 1/16") diameter hole saw.
- File out the hole with a round and square file as illustrated.
- Remove any swarf.
- Take the electrical socket from the kit. Install and tighten the electrical socket using the nut on the rear.
- Remove the two clips and fold the insulation to one side.
- Locate and disconnect the 2 pin connector which is taped to the car's cable harness.
- Fold the insulation back. At the same time insert the cable harness through the slit at the upper edge of the insulation.
- Reinstall the clips.
- Reinstall the side panel. At the same time connect the cable harness to the socket.
- Tighten the screws for the loading eyelets to 24 Nm (17.7 lbf.ft).
- Install the covers.
Reinstall:
- headlining panels
- the sill trim panel
- the floor hatch
- the C-pillar panel
- the side cushion.
- Reinstall the seat cushion and backrest.
